    Busy on a Tuesday at lunch time, so we took it to go and ate lunch on the beach down the street, the guy who took our order was fast and efficient and still friendly and welcoming, not rude or anything, even when there was a rush. He ran a tight ship! Food came out quick and hot! No complaints, napkins, straws, utensils, everything to go was in the bag already waiting, we were out the door quickly and away we went. Very good system they were running there. I recommend if you want good quick seafood on the coast! I got the combo, 2 cod 1 halibut 2 big shrimp, and a big mound of curly fries (you can pick reg fries or chips too) and slaw) and the sauce is good too. Not bad for the price! This place isn't fancy but it's great food. It was busy in the middle of the week so you know it's worth it.

    We were looking for a good place to have some fish and chips. This place was beyond good!!! It's a small spot, with explicit instructions when you enter (I'm assuming they get a lot of traffic and need to keep it moving). We were kindly greeted! We ordered at the counter and were then instructed which table at which to sit. I had the three piece of Cod, my husband had the combo which included cod, halibut and shrimp. The food was served piping hot and was AMAZING! The breading was a thin crunchy batter instead of that thick beady batter. And their tartar sauce - not sure if it was homemade but it was fantastic! It had large pieces of pickle in it and wasn't super sweet. All in all, a fantastic place to eat fish.
